Parts Needed to Flat Tow a 1997 Saturn SL Sedan Behind a Motor Home  

Question:

I need to know exactly what base plate I need for my 1997 Saturn sl I need this car to be towable asap and dont have time to order the wrong one can you help me

Expert Reply:

For your 1997 Saturn SL sedan I recommend Roadmaster base plates # 52181-1. These base plates have removable arms so you won't have fixed arms sticking out in front of the car all the time.

For a compatible tow bar I recommend the Falcon 2 # RM-520. This is a motor home mount tow bar rated up to 6,000 pounds. I have included a link to a video review of this tow bar for you.

If you wanted something more budget friendly but with less features you could use the Tracker tow bar # RM-020 with quick disconnects # RM-201. I have linked a video review of this tow bar as well. You may also need a high/low adapter to keep the tow bar level. I have included a link to our help article that explains how to measure to get the right size.

For safety cables I recommend # RM-643. The coiled design helps keep the cables off of the ground. For lighting you can use the Roadmaster # RM-2120..

And finally, most states now require supplemental braking on the vehicle being flat towed. One of the preferred systems for our installers and what I recommend is the SMI Stay-IN-Play DUO proportional system, # SM99251. It will apply the vehicle brakes in proportion to how much the tow vehicle is braking. This is the safest way to stop and it reduces wear and tear on both vehicles.

Be sure to consult your vehicle owners manual for specific information on flat towing the vehicle. I have also included some helpful links to our series of help articles on flat towing for you.
